164 Collapsible power-driven table stand US14276998 2014-05-13 US09271567B2 2016-03-01 Chou-Hsin Wu
A collapsible power-driven table stand includes a supporting body of an elongated shape, a first stand having a first driving member and a plurality of first extendable rods driven by the first driving member to move axially relative to each other and a second stand having a second driving member and a plurality of second extendable rods driven by the second driving member to move axially relative to each other. The first driving member is pivotally attached to one end of the supporting body and the second driving member is also pivotally attached to another end of the supporting body in order to allow both the first and second stands to extend/collapse relative to the supporting body. Accordingly, the assembly of the collapsible power-driven table is simplified and the overall size thereof is reduced.

166 Table having adjustable legs US14681229 2015-04-08 US09247816B2 2016-02-02 Todd Sorrell
A table having independently adjustable legs. The table includes a tabletop having a bubble level thereon for allowing a user to determine if the tabletop is level. The tabletop may further include adjustable side rails that can be used to help prevent objects from falling off of the side of the tabletop. A plurality of legs extends from the underside of the tabletop, wherein each leg includes an upper section and a lower section movably positioned therein. A foot is pivotally connected to the lower end of each leg to enable the table to be positioned on uneven surfaces. Thus, the table allows a user to maintain the tabletop in a level orientation on uneven or sloped surfaces.
167 EXPANDABLE AND FOLDABLE MAYO STAND US14678531 2015-04-03 US20160008070A1 2016-01-14 Sambhu N. CHOUDHURY; Arturo D. SANCHEZ; Sean N. LYNCH
An expandable and foldable mayo stand has a support column having first and second ends and a longitudinal axis. A table top is connected to the first end of the support column, and a base is connected to the second end of the support column. The table top is formed in two halves having a hinge connection extending along a hinge axis perpendicular to the longitudinal axis, whereby the table top halves can be pivoted between an open position in which they are coplanar and a collapsed position in which they are substantially parallel. The base has a central portion with wings hinged thereto; each wing has a plurality of legs connected to it by respective pin connections, so that the legs can be folded from a deployed configuration to a compact storage configuration.

170 HEIGHT-ADJUSTABLE TABLE US14706488 2015-05-07 US20150320198A1 2015-11-12 Hamid Zebarjad; Adam Douglas Haworth Sinclair; Hanna Shaheen; Bin Yu
An apparatus for a height-adjustable table is described. The apparatus can include a frame for supporting a work surface; a pair of lower legs supporting the frame; a pulley mechanism coupling the frame and the pair of lower legs for vertically moving the frame relative to the pair of lower legs; and a spring located within a passage extending through the frame. The spring may have a fixed end secured to the frame and a movable end movable relative to the frame over a first distance for exerting a force over the first distance. The apparatus can have a block-and-tackle assembly located within the passage. The block-and-tackle assembly can couple the movable end of the spring to the pulley mechanism. The block-and-tackle assembly can transfer the force exerted by the spring over the first distance to vertical movement of the frame relative to the pair of lower legs over a second distance, where the second distance is greater than the first distance.

172 Lifting column, preferably for height adjustable tables US14363018 2012-12-05 US09144301B2 2015-09-29 Martin Riis; Ulrik N. Rasmussen
A lifting column preferably, for height adjustable tables, includes a guide (5) and a drive unit (9), the guide (5) including at least a first member (5a) and a second member (5b), the members (5a, 5b, 5c) being arranged mutually telescopically relative to each other. At the end of the first member (5a) from which the second member (5b) can be displaced sliders are arranged on an internal side thereof. At the end of the second member (5b) extending into the first member (5a) sliders are likewise arranged on the outside thereof. In a first plane the sliders have a first, a large, prestressing between the first member (5a) and the second member (5b), while the sliders in the second plane have a second, a small, prestressing between the first (5a) and second member (5b). Thus, a good dampening of vibrations of the table is achieved in case of exposure to horizontal forces.
173 Collapsible table US14044321 2013-10-02 US09119465B2 2015-09-01 Daniel R. Grace
A collapsible table structure comprises a tabletop and a plurality of folding leg assemblies pivotally attached thereto. Each leg assembly comprises a first leg and a second leg connected to each other at a pivot coupling defining an unintruding common axis for movement between an open condition generally resembling an X-shaped configuration and a closed condition wherein the legs, as well as the tabletop, are generally parallelly disposed in a common plane. Each leg is formed by at least two telescopically connected leg sections freely movable through and transversely of the unintruding common axis in moving between extended and retracted positions relative to each other. Each leg includes a locking mechanism for retaining a lower leg section in an extended position. The table structure further includes means for releasing the locking mechanism to facilitate collapsing of the table to its closed condition.
174 Deployable Table for a Spare Tire Assembly US14701927 2015-05-01 US20150230599A1 2015-08-20 Dan C. LARIMER
A deployable table for an external spare tire assembly is an apparatus that provides a user with a fold-out shelf while the apparatus is attached to the spare tire assembly or provides the user with a table while the apparatus is detached from the spare tire assembly. The apparatus includes an adapter mount, a dual compression clamp, a central hub, a table frame, a table top, and foldable legs. The adapter mount allows the apparatus to detachably attach to the external spare tire assembly. The central hub is connected normal to the table frame, which is used to support the table top. The table top has a stationary portion and a fold-out portion that is used as the shelf. The foldable legs collapse within the table frame or can extend when the apparatus is used as a table. The dual compression clamp connects the central hub to the adapter mount.

178 Height adjustable table US12585213 2009-09-08 US08752488B2 2014-06-17 Tommy Møller
A height-adjustable table that includes a table top having first and second ends and two long sides, and at least one table leg at each end, each table leg including a linear actuator with a rectangular motor housing (21) containing an electric motor and a gear. A spindle unit has an upper end is mounted in an opening in the bottom (26) of a rear end of the motor housing and is connected to the gear. Each table leg also includes a telescopic guide (17) with a fixed member (18) and at least one telescopic member (19,20), the telescopic guide surrounding the spindle unit of the actuator and is with one end connected to the bottom (26) of the motor housing (21). The linear actuator is with the motor housing (21) secured to the table top in such a manner that the motor housing (21) with its rear end (22) faces towards a long side (13) and with its front end (23) faces towards the other long side (14) of the table top.
